FTP Connect, Examine Server Certificate, and then Authenticate

Demonstrates how to connect to an FTP server, examine the server's SSL/TLS certificate, and then, if it meets the application's security requirements, proceed to authenticate.

bool success = false;

// This example assumes Chilkat Ftp2 to have been previously unlocked.
// See Unlock Ftp2 for sample code.

Chilkat.Ftp2 ftp = new Chilkat.Ftp2();

ftp.Hostname = "www.authtls-ftps-server.com";
ftp.Username = "FTP_LOGIN";
ftp.Password = "FTP_PASSWORD";
ftp.AuthTls = true;
ftp.Port = 21;

// Connect to the FTP server using explicit TLS (AUTH TLS).
success = ftp.ConnectOnly();
if (success == false) {
    Debug.WriteLine(ftp.LastErrorText);
    return;
}

// Get the FTP server's certificate.
Chilkat.Cert serverCert = new Chilkat.Cert();
success = ftp.GetServerCert(serverCert);
if (success == false) {
    Debug.WriteLine(ftp.LastErrorText);
    return;
}

// Now that we have the certificate, we can check it in any way we desire.
// (See the online reference documentation for the certificate object's methods
// and properties)...

// Assuming the certificate is OK, proceed to authenticate with the FTP server.
success = ftp.LoginAfterConnectOnly();
if (success == false) {
    Debug.WriteLine(ftp.LastErrorText);
    return;
}

// 
// Proceed with uploading/download files, etc...
// 

ftp.Disconnect();
Debug.WriteLine("Success.");
